util/thash: fix memcap consolidate function
The function THashConsolidateMemcap is used to allow to load a
dataset even when the memcap is not set. But the implementation
was in fact resetting the memcap value to the max of memory
usaga after loading and default memcap. As a result, the
function was resetting memcap to the default memcap even if
a huge memcap was set in the dataset definition. In the case
of dataset where we add to the set it was leading to memcap
limit hitting despite the settings of memcap by the user.
This patch udpates the code to set the final memcap value to
the max of memory usage after loading and set memcap.

protodetect: improve midstream handling
Set "done flag" only if parsers for both directions are not found in a
case of midstream parsers from other direction are tried if nothing is found
for the initial one. "done flag" must be set if nothing is found in both
directions. Otherwise processing of incomplete data is terminated at the very
first try.

dcerpc/udp: improve detection
Lately, Wireguard proto starting w pattern |04 00| is misdetected as
DCERPC/UDP which also starts with the same pattern, add more checks
to make sure that it is the best guess for packet to be dcerpc/udp.

libsuricata-config: program to print build flags
Following the pattern of many other libraries, provide a -config
program to output cflags and libs to properly link an application
against the library.
--cflags and --libs can be used infividually or together.
--static will link against the static libraries instead of the
shared library. Note that if the shared library is not available,
the static libraries will be provided even without this option.

build: use a static convenience library for C code
With the circular reference gone, we can now make use
of a convenience library for the Suricata program
as well as any other programs that depend on the same
source such as the fuzzer.
While its not a libtool convenience library, it serves
the same purpose and is a common idiom in Make and CMake
projects whereas the COMMON_SOURCES approach was more
of a hack we had to resort to until the circular
reference was resolved.

rust/ffi: provide AppLayerRegisterParser in context
AppLayerRegisterParser was creating a link error when attempting
to use a convenience library for the Suricata C code, then linking
the library of C code with the library of Rust code into a final
Suricata executable, or use with fuzz targets.
By moving AppLayerRegisterParser to the context structure and
calling it like a callback the circular reference is removed
allowing the convenience libraries to work again.
This is also a stepping block to proving a Suricata library
as a single .a or .so file.

detect: fix heap overflow issue with buffer setup
In some cases, the InspectionBufferGet function would be followed by
a failure to set the buffer up, for example due to a HTTP body limit
not yet being reached. Yet each call to InspectionBufferGet would lead
to the matching list_id to be added to the
DetectEngineThreadCtx::inspect.to_clear_queue. This array is sized to
add each list only once, but in this case the same id could be added
multiple times, potentially overflowing the array.

suricata: avoid at exit crash in nfq mode
When Suricata was build with ebpf support and when it was started
in NFQ mode, it was crashing at exit because it was trying to free
the device extension.
This patch fixes the issue by only trigger the eBPF related code
when Suricata is running in AFP_PACKET mode.
